Key Features to Look For
You need socks that work well with minimalist shoes. Here’s what to keep in mind:
- Toe Separations: Some socks have individual toe pockets. These are great! They let your toes move freely. They also help prevent blisters.
- Low Cut or No-Show: You don’t want socks that peek out! Look for socks that sit below your ankle. This keeps the minimalist look.
- Thin Design: Thick socks don’t work well. They change how your shoes fit. Thin socks let your feet feel the ground.
- Snug Fit: The socks should fit well. They shouldn’t bunch up inside your shoe. This can cause blisters.
- Breathability: Your feet sweat. Choose socks that let air flow. This keeps your feet dry and comfortable.
Important Materials
The material of your socks matters a lot. Here are some good choices:
- Merino Wool: This is a popular choice. It’s soft, warm, and wicks away moisture. It also resists odors.
- Synthetic Fibers (like polyester or nylon): These materials are durable. They also dry quickly. They are good for exercise.
- Blends: Many socks use a mix of materials. This can give you the best of both worlds. You can get the comfort of wool with the durability of synthetics.
- Cotton: Cotton is soft and comfortable. But, it takes a long time to dry. It’s not always the best choice for exercise.

FAQ: Sock It To ‘Em!
Q: Why do I need special socks for minimalist shoes?
A: Regular socks can be too thick. They can also bunch up. Special socks fit better and let your toes move freely.
Q: What’s the best material for socks?
A: Merino wool, synthetic fibers, and blends are all good choices. It depends on your needs.
Q: How do I prevent blisters?
A: Choose well-fitting socks. Make sure they are thin and don’t bunch up. Consider socks with individual toe pockets.
